Summer internship at Boehringer Ingelheim

May 30, 2012 § Leave a comment

A summer internship position just opened up in the Systems Biology Group at Boehringer Ingelheim.  This is an excellent opportunity for a grad student or an undergrad with a strong biology, modeling, or applied math background to learn more about how systems biology and pharmacology are applied to drug discovery.

To be eligible for the program applicants must be able to work in the US, and they must be a current student in good standing with a minimum cumulative GPA of 3.2 (out of 4).  The position is paid and includes housing for the summer at the Boehringer Ingelheim Ridgefield CT campus.
